In the pursuit of society’s welfare, especially towards children suffering from poverty, on 21st March 2015, Navigos Search went on a charity trip to Ta Van Secondary Boarding School at Ta Van village, Sapa Town, Lao Cai. The school has more than 250 students in the age of 11-14, including 200 boarding students, mostly of Day, H’Mong and Dao ethnic groups, who are studying in a highly lacking condition of food, necessities and learning equipments.
Ms. Ha, North Regional Director, represented the company to give donation to the school’s representative. The donation package could help the students there improve their learning and living condition with necessary goods such as notebooks, pencils and instant noodle. The school’s students also greeted the company with several dancing performances on bright and cheerful songs, which attracted many foreign tourists around.
